About the Driscoll 78351 market
What is the median home price in Driscoll 78351, TX?
The median sale price in Driscoll 78351, TX is $150,000 (data through July 2025), based on deeds recorded with the county.
How many homes sell in Driscoll 78351, TX each year?
1 homes sold in Driscoll 78351, TX over the last 12 months (data through July 2025). TopHap counts recorded arm's-length deeds, not listings, so the figure is not affected by which brokerage handled the sale.
How many homes are there in Driscoll 78351, TX?
Driscoll 78351, TX contains 273 residential properties, with a median of 1,204 square feet, built around 1982. The median TopHap Estimate is $100K.
How does Driscoll 78351, TX compare to the rest of Nueces County?
By median home value, Driscoll 78351, TX is the 19th most expensive of 23 ZIP codes in Nueces County. Its typical home is worth more than 10% of all homes in Nueces County. Corpus Christi 78416 ranks just above it and Corpus Christi 78402 just below. The ranking is rebuilt nightly from the county assessor record of every home in each area.
Do people own or rent in Driscoll 78351, TX?
50% of homes in Driscoll 78351, TX are owner-occupied. 3% are held by a company rather than an individual.
How much equity do owners in Driscoll 78351, TX hold?
76% of mortgaged homes in Driscoll 78351, TX are equity-rich, meaning the loan balance is under half the home's value. 1.5% owe more than the home is worth.
